Here is my problem:
I have XP (home ed.) on my new Dell (about 3 months old now) and the Spell Checker stopped working after I did a the Windows Critical Updates for my computer two days ago. The spell check was working fine before and now it is kaputz. I know that if I had Word, Excel or Powerpoint installed that it would function again but I can't figure out why it did work before doing the updates? I was told that if I install Front Page or Publisher and then uninstall that the spell checker might be left behind. Has anyone done this?? Any clues??

I have no idea why you had a spell checking capability without having Word, Excel, or PowerPoint installed on your system. Installing FrontPage or Publisher will not help, as only the three programs you mentioned provide spell checking for Outlook Express.
A free spelling checker for OE for those who don't have the Microsoft programs installed is available here.
